嵌入式开发技术智能硬件系统设计与应用

嵌入式开发技术智能硬件系统设计与应用

什么是嵌入式开发?

在当今这个科技日新月异的时代,人们生活中所见的各种电子设备,无论是手机、平板电脑还是智能家居,都离不开一种特殊的技术——嵌入式开发。那么,嵌入式开发又是什么呢?它是一种将计算机硬件和软件相结合,以实现特定功能的工程实践。在这里,我们将深入探讨这项技术背后的世界。

为什么需要嵌体开发?

为了理解为什么我们需要这种技术,让我们首先回顾一下传统计算机系统。它们通常由一个操作系统、应用程序以及用户界面组成。但对于许多现代设备来说,这种结构已经无法满足其需求。例如,一台智能家用电器可能只需要执行一些简单任务,比如控制温控器或打开灯光,而不需要复杂的图形用户界面或者大量资源消耗的操作系统。这就是嵌入式系统发挥作用的地方,它通过专门设计来优化资源使用,并且能够在有限条件下运行。

如何进行嵌体开发?

进行嵌体开发时,我们首先要考虑的是目标平台,即我们的设备会安装在哪里,以及它能做什么。然后,我们会选择合适的编程语言和工具链来确保我们的代码能够高效地工作。此外,由于资源限制,常见的问题包括内存管理、处理速度和功耗控制等,因此这些因素也必须被考虑到。在实际项目中,这意味着对每个决策都要精心权衡,以达到最佳效果。

哪些领域适用于嵵体发展?

尽管“专业级”的概念让人联想到高度专业化的人群,但事实上,任何想要利用电子产品增强生活质量的人都可以从中受益。不仅工业自动化、汽车电子和医疗设备依赖于这样的技术,而且消费者市场中的物联网(IoT)产品也同样如此,从便携式游戏机到家庭娱乐中心,再到无线音箱,每一款都是依靠精妙而微小但却极为重要的心智力量打造出来。

怎么保证安全性与稳定性?

随着越来越多的人开始依赖这些基于软件驱动的小型设备,对安全性的关注自然也随之提升了。因此,在构建任何类型的大规模网络或单一硬件项目时,都必须牢记安全性至关重要。一方面,要确保所有通信都是加密并经过验证;另一方面,也不能忽视对固件更新及维护的一致努力,因为这是防止潜在漏洞出现并保持整体性能的一大关键点。

未来看待本领域有何展望?

随着时间推移,我们可以预见到更高级别集成软硬件解决方案将不断涌现,其中包括更先进的算法、大数据分析能力以及可持续能源管理等。而对于普通消费者而言,他们最终将拥有更多更加个人化、高效且节能环保的小型智能助手,无论是在家里还是出行途中,只需轻触屏幕就能获得所需服务。如果说过去几十年是数字革命,那么接下来的几十年则很可能属于“连接革命”,即全球各个角落之间信息流通变得更加自由开放,让人类社会进一步向前迈进一步。这一切正是因为那些默默无闻但不可或缺的人们——他们正在以各种方式,为我们的未来打下坚实基础。